First Telephone Call…..

March 10, 1876…..

Alexander Graham Bell calls his assistant in the next room: “Mr. Watson, come here, I want you.”

Great White Hurricane of 1888

March 11, 1888…..

One of the most famous snow storms in U.S. history, killing 400 people and creating 50-foot (15 m) snow drifts. It lasted for four days with snowfalls up to 58 inches (147 cm) in Saratoga Springs, New York. The destruction of telegraph lines led to their being placed underground in the future.

Dennis the Menace…..

March 12, 1951…..

Hank Ketcham‘s comic strip Dennis the Menace debuts. It was based on his real-life son, Dennis Ketcham, who earned the nickname “Dennis the Menace” when he was four years old.
